Martin Winstone

Senior Historical Advisor to the Holocaust Educational Trust

Martin Winstone is Senior Historical Advisor to the Holocaust Educational Trust and Project Historian for the UK Holocaust Memorial, which is currently in development in London. He is an expert on the history of the Holocaust in Poland as well as on the history and nature of Holocaust sites across Europe. His first book, The Holocaust Sites of Europe (first published 2010; third edition, 2024), is a comprehensive guide to Holocaust-related sites, including camps, mass shooting sites and ghettos. He is also the author of The Dark Heart of Hitler’s Europe (2014), a history of the General Government, the region of German-occupied Poland which was the central killing ground of the Holocaust. Martin has frequently appeared as a commentator on the Holocaust on television and radio and in the press.
